Federal Regulations for Drinking Water
The federal government, through the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A), sets guidelines for drinking water quality. These guidelines establish maximum contaminant levels to protect public health. These regulations are meticulously crafted to ensure that the water we drink meets the highest standards of safety and purity.
Under the federal regulations, water suppliers are required to regularly test the water to ensure that it meets the established standards. This testing includes monitoring for various contaminants, such as bacteria, viruses, heavy metals, and chemicals. The EPA's guidelines also outline the necessary treatment processes that water suppliers must follow to remove or reduce these contaminants to safe levels.

State Regulations for Drinking Water in South Carolina
In addition to federal regulations, individual states also have their own standards. South Carolina, like many other states, has stringent policies in place to ensure the safety of drinking water.
The South Carolina Department of Health and Environmental Control (DHEC) is responsible for overseeing the state's drinking water programs. They work in conjunction with the EPA to enforce regulations and monitor the quality of the water supply.
